Gretchen Felker-Martin, acclaimed author of Manhunt, delivers a gripping new horror novel about a group of teens who must remain true to themselves while enduring the horrors of a nightmarish conversion camp.
"A soaring, boundless ode to queer survival. It's flat-out mesmerizing." —Paul Tremblay, author of The Pallbearers Club
Something evil is buried deep in the desert. It wants your body. It wears your skin.
In the summer of 1995, seven queer kids abandoned by their parents at a remote conversion camp came face to face with a malevolent force. They survived—but at Camp Resolution, everybody leaves a different person. Sixteen years later, the scarred and broken survivors of that terrible summer must confront the same horror again. Only they can stop it before it’s too late, carrying the weight of the world’s fate on their shoulders.
Felker-Martin weaves a tale of survival, resilience, and the enduring spirit of those who fight against oppression. This novel is a testament to the strength of queer identity, exploring the depths of trauma and the power of unity in the face of unimaginable evil. 📚❤️
